Sims Metal Management acquiring metal recycling company assets
Sims Metal Management, the listed metal and electronic recycling company, has announced that its subsidiary Sims Group Australia Holdings Limited (SimsMM Australia) has signed an agreement for the purchase of the assets of Commercial Metal Recycling Services (CMRS).
CMRS is a metal recycler that operates a network of eight yards across Queensland. The company operates from three locations in Brisbane, and five regional centres in Townsville, Cairns, Toowoomba, Gladstone and the Sunshine Coast. CMRS collects approximately 75,000 tonnes of ferrous scrap and 7000 tonnes of non-ferrous scrap per annum.
The acquisition is subject to clearance from the Australian Competition & Consumer Commission. The financial terms of the transaction were not disclosed, however the purchase price consideration is not material to Sims Metal Management Limited.
